One of the biggest factors for economic growth of any nation is agriculture. India, being one of the mass-producing countries in the world of different crops, still relies on traditional techniques rather than advancement over fields. Various advancements in field of agriculture have increased competence of certain farming activities making them reliable and convenient. Farmers face problems in coping with the changing climatic conditions as India has different weather & soil conditions in different regions. The introduction of IoT and machine learning-based smart agriculture aims to solve this issue and assist farmers in increasing yield quality and productivity. In addition to providing real-time agricultural monitoring assistance, it also offers suggestions for crops and fertilizers. The major goal of this study is to propose an Internet of Things (IoT) based Smart Agriculture system that would assist farmers in receiving suggestions based on a variety of parameters, such as temperature, pH, humidity.
